[HISTORY: Adopted by the Rockland County Legislature 6-1-2004 by Res. No. 287-2004. Amendments noted where applicable.]
Pursuant to § 5 of the General Municipal Law, the Legislature of Rockland County hereby determines that it is in the public interest to permit the acceptance by certain officers of the County of Rockland of credit cards as a means of payment of taxes, fees and other charges as set forth in § 5 of the General Municipal Law.
A. 
The Legislature of Rockland County hereby authorizes agreements with one or more financing agencies or card issuers to provide for acceptance, by the County Clerk, the Commissioner of Finance, Commissioner of Hospitals, Commissioner of Health, Commissioner of Mental Health and their designees, of credit cards as a means of payment of fines, civil penalties, rent, rates, taxes, fees, charges, revenue, financial obligations or other amounts, including penalties, special assessments and interest, owed to the County of Rockland.
B. 
Pursuant to § 5 of the General Municipal Law, the Legislature of Rockland County hereby determines that it is in the public interest to permit the acceptance by the Office of Consumer Protection and the Department of Probation of credit cards as a means of payment of civil penalties, fines, fees, restitutions and other financial obligations and charges as set forth in § 5 of the General Municipal Law.
[Added 8-2-2005 by Res. No. 409-2005]
The agreements referred to in this chapter shall govern the terms and conditions upon which a credit card proffered as a means of payment of fines, civil penalties, rent, rates, taxes, fees, charges, revenue, financial obligations or other amounts, including penalties, special assessments and interest, shall be accepted or declined and the manner in and conditions upon which the financing agency or card issuer shall pay to the County of Rockland the amounts of the fines, civil penalties, rent, rates, taxes, fees, charges, revenue, financial obligations or other amounts, including penalties, special assessments and interest, paid by means of a credit card pursuant to such agreement.
The agreements referred to this chapter shall provide that as a condition for accepting payment by credit card, such person offering payment by credit or charge card pay a service fee to the County of Rockland not to exceed the costs incurred by the County of Rockland in connection with the credit or charge card payment transaction, including any fee owed by the County of Rockland to the financing agency or card issuer arising from that transaction.
The underlying debt, lien, obligation, bill, account or other amount owed to the County of Rockland for which payment by credit card is accepted by the County of Rockland shall not be expunged, cancelled, released, discharged or satisfied, and any receipt or other evidence of payment shall be deemed conditional, until the County of Rockland has received final and unconditional payment of the full amount due from the financing agency or card issuer for such credit card transaction.
There shall be signage at the County locations where credit card payments will be accepted for payment of County fees or taxes which shall state that the County will make no profit on any credit card surcharge and that the added fee for credit card usage shall be only to cover the fees charged the County by the specific credit card company associated with the credit card usage.
